7 Practical Tips for Buying Wholesale Diamonds

  • Tip 1. Know Your Source: Traceability & Ethics:
  • Understand where the diamond originates. Ethically sourced diamonds ensure that you’re not inadvertently supporting conflict diamonds or unfair labor practices.
  • Opt for dealers that have transparent supply chains and certifications to back their claims.
  • Tip 2. Check Certification & Grading:
  • Always request a diamond grading report from an accredited gemological lab. The report should match the diamond and its listed characteristics.
  • It’s essential to verify that the certification comes from a reputable organization, such as the Gemological Institute of America (GIA) or the American Gem Society (AGS).
  • Tip 3. Understand Pricing & Markup:
  • Wholesale diamonds often have a considerably lower markup compared to retail stores. However, even within the wholesale domain, prices can vary.
  • Research the average wholesale prices for the type of diamond you’re interested in. This knowledge will empower you during the negotiation process.
  • Tip 4. Beware of Synthetics & Treatments:
  • The market has seen a surge in lab-grown diamonds, which are legitimate but differ from natural diamonds in origin and sometimes price.
  • Be cautious of diamonds that have undergone treatments to enhance their appearance. Always inquire if the diamond has been treated in any way and insist on it being documented.
  • Tip 5. Ask About Buy-Back or Upgrade Policies:
  • Some dealers offer policies that allow you to upgrade your diamond in the future or buy it back for a percentage of the original price. This can be a helpful safety net and may influence your buying decision.
  • Tip 6. Establish a Trustworthy Relationship:
  • This is a significant purchase, both emotionally and financially. Establish a rapport with your dealer. Honest and reputable dealers will be transparent, answer your questions thoroughly, and not rush the buying process.
  • Recommendations, online reviews, and industry reputation can help gauge a dealer’s reliability.
  • Tip 7. Examine the Ring Setting:
  • Beyond the diamond itself, consider the quality and craftsmanship of the ring setting. Ensure that the metal complements the diamond and that the design ensures the diamond’s security.

Understanding Wholesale Diamonds

The first thing we would tell you is not to look for it. There are multiple ways to buy a diamond that might be outside of your budget range, financing being one of them. But before you think about financing, you can always look into the wholesale market, which can offer diamonds at a far reduced cost compared to retail prices. 

For those unaware, the wholesale diamond market refers to the sector of the diamond industry where diamonds are bought and sold in large quantities directly from diamond suppliers. Wholesale diamond dealers, of course, have a direct partnership with manufacturers or suppliers, bypassing the need for retailers and selling their diamonds at a far more competitive price as a result. 

They still adhere to industry standards, meaning each diamond is graded and certified, only the direct sourcing and bulk purchasing nature leads to diamonds selling for lower prices, with a wealth of variety and selection. Additionally, buying wholesale provides access to rare and unique diamonds that might not be available in typical retail settings. This can be particularly advantageous if you’re looking for something truly distinctive. Exploring wholesale options allows you to find the perfect diamond that matches your criteria without compromising on quality or breaking your budget.

Choosing the Right Diamond: The 4Cs Explained

It’s important to remember, after all, that the emphasis of buying that dream diamond is on you, and no one else. You have to have a vision in your mind – a clear idea of what you want your diamond to look like, with its qualities and characteristics falling in line with your desires and your budget. This starts with understanding the 4Cs. In the diamond world, the 4Cs refer to the cut, color, clarity, and carat of a diamond – characteristics that will determine its beauty, elegance, brilliance, and sparkle.

  • Cut

We have written in-depth about the 4Cs elsewhere on the site, but to give you a quick description, the cut refers to the proportions, symmetry, and polish of a diamond, all of which have been carefully crafted by an expert jeweller. Click here to find out more.

  • Color

The color of a diamond refers to the presence or absence of color, graded on a scale from D (colorless) to Z (a light brown or yellow color). Diamonds with less color are rarer and typically more valuable, while diamonds with color can be cheaper due to their inability to reflect light more effectively. Our full guide is available here.

  • Clarity

Diamond clarity refers to any internal or external imperfections, known as inclusions and blemishes. This is graded on a scale ranging from ‘Flawless’ to ‘Included’, with varying degrees of clarity in between. Read our full guide to clarity.

  • Carat

We spoke before about carat weights and how they can affect the weight of the money you’ll need in your pocket! But while the carat of a diamond will directly influence the price, it’s not just the size of the diamond that does so. The carat of a diamond will also impact its overall brilliance and sparkle, with larger diamonds having more surface area for light to enter and reflect. Click here to find out more.

10 Frequently Asked Questions about Wholesale Diamonds and Diamond Dealers

  • Q1. What makes wholesale diamonds cheaper than retail?
  • Answer: Wholesale diamonds are cheaper due to lower overhead costs and the absence of retail markup. Buying directly from a wholesaler means you’re paying closer to the original price of sourcing the diamond.
  • Q2. How can I verify the quality of a wholesale diamond?
  • Answer: Always request a grading report from a reputable gemological laboratory, such as the GIA or AGS. This report details the diamond’s 4Cs (Cut, Color, Clarity, and Carat weight) and ensures its quality.
  • Q3. Can I buy a single diamond from a wholesale dealer?
  • Answer: Yes, individual buyers can purchase single diamonds from wholesale dealers. While wholesalers typically sell in bulk, many cater to individual needs, especially for significant purchases like engagement rings.
  • Q4. Are wholesale diamonds conflict-free?
  • Answer: Reputable wholesale diamond dealers adhere to the Kimberley Process to ensure their diamonds are conflict-free. However, always verify the dealer’s certifications and ask about their sourcing practices.
  • Q5. What’s the difference between lab-grown and natural diamonds in the wholesale market?
  • Answer: Lab-grown diamonds are created in controlled environments, making them an ethical and often less expensive choice. Natural diamonds are mined from the earth. Both can be found in the wholesale market, with lab-grown options typically being more affordable.
  • Q6. How do online wholesale diamond dealers offer lower prices?
  • Answer: Online dealers have lower operational costs than traditional brick-and-mortar stores, allowing them to offer diamonds at a lower markup. Additionally, the competitive online market drives prices down.
  • Q7. Is it safe to buy diamonds online from a wholesale dealer?
  • Answer: Yes, it’s safe as long as you choose a reputable dealer. Look for online reviews, secure payment methods, and comprehensive return policies. Also, ensure they provide detailed diamond certification.
  • Q8. What should I look for in a wholesale diamond dealer?
  • Answer: Look for transparency in pricing and diamond sourcing, a wide selection of certified diamonds, positive customer reviews, and responsive customer service. Also, check for buy-back or upgrade policies.
  • Q9. Do I need to be an industry insider to purchase from a diamond wholesaler?
  • Answer: No, many wholesalers are open to selling to individual buyers, especially for significant purchases like engagement rings or other fine jewelry.
  • Q10. Can I customize an engagement ring with a wholesale diamond?
  • Answer: Absolutely. Many wholesale diamond dealers offer custom ring design services, allowing you to create a unique piece that matches your style and budget.
